Mageweave Cloth Farming
Mageweave Cloth is the fourth fabric available for players to farm after Linen, Wool and Silk. It has a few different uses in the game, including being used for the new Mageweave gear set and it can also be turned in to your capital city for reputation with your faction.
There are a few locations that are good for farming this item, including Sratholme and Zul'farrak. The best place to go, however, is in dungeons. The Library and Armory wings of Scarlet Monastery have lots of mobs that drop the cloth.
Another good spot is in Jintha'alor. The trolls there have about a 30% chance to drop Mageweave cloth. They also drop Wildvine which is a high-value crafting material that can be sold for quite a lot of gold. It is also used for some high-level Tailoring recipes and can be a useful crafting material for Blacksmiths, Engineers and First Aid players. The enemies there range from Level 40 to Level 50.

The first step in maximizing your skinning profits is to find a good farming spot. In the Northrend zones of Howling Fjord and Borean Tundra, there are plenty of worgs to kill that drop arctic leather and meat which sell for a lot of money on the Auction House. Additionally, the Defias in Booty Bay drop linen cloth and a high chance of vendor trash that can be sold for four to six times its purchase price. The northeast coast of Tanaris also has lots of turtles that drop loads of Turtle Scale and Turtle Meat which can be sold for a profit as well. All of these items are useful for crafting.

In addition, players can also sell items on the Auction House. A good way to make gold is by grinding Dark Iron Ordinance. This item can be collected from Dark Iron Dwarf elite mobs in the northeastern portion of Wetlands. The item is in high demand at the Auction House and can be sold for a decent amount of money.
